Courtyard Sealing in Renton, WA

Courtyard sealing services involve applying a protective coating to outdoor paved surfaces such as concrete, stone, or brick patios and walkways. This process helps to prevent damage from moisture, staining, and wear caused by foot traffic and weather conditions. Homeowners often seek courtyard sealing to maintain the appearance of their outdoor spaces, enhance durability, and extend the lifespan of their paving materials. Projects can range from sealing a small backyard patio to large outdoor entertainment areas, ensuring the surfaces remain resilient and visually appealing over time.

Before requesting courtyard sealing, property owners typically want to understand the condition of their existing surfaces, including any cracks, stains, or signs of deterioration. It’s important to consider the type of paving material, as different surfaces may require specific sealants or preparation steps. Additionally, understanding the desired finish-such as matte, semi-gloss, or high-gloss-can help achieve the preferred look and performance. Proper surface cleaning and preparation are essential to ensure the sealant adheres correctly and provides effective protection.

Project Types

Common Courtyard Sealing Jobs

Concrete sealing - helps protect driveway and patio surfaces from stains and damage.

Stone sealing - preserves the appearance and durability of natural stone surfaces.

Paver sealing - enhances color and provides a protective barrier against weathering.

Brick sealing - prevents moisture penetration and reduces efflorescence buildup.

Outdoor surface sealing - extends the lifespan of walkways, steps, and other exterior features.

Sealing maintenance - involves reapplication to keep surfaces protected over time.

FAQ

Courtyard Sealing Questions

What is courtyard sealing? Courtyard sealing involves applying a protective coating to surface materials to prevent damage from weather, stains, and wear.

Which surfaces can be sealed? Common surfaces include concrete, pavers, brick, and stone used in courtyards and outdoor patios.

Why should property owners consider sealing their courtyard? Sealing helps maintain the appearance, extends the lifespan of surfaces, and reduces maintenance needs.

How often should a courtyard be resealed? Typically, resealing every few years helps preserve the surface and maintain its protective qualities.
